Input: atkbd - skip deactivate for HONOR FMB-P's internal keyboard
After commit9cf6e24c9f("Input: atkbd - do not skip atkbd_deactivate() when skipping ATKBD_CMD_GETID"), HONOR FMB-P, aka HONOR MagicBook Pro 14 2025's internal keyboard stops working. Adding the atkbd_deactivate_fixup quirk fixes it.
